Itching On Penis Tip, Penile Ulcers, Sore Throat, Lesion On Gums. Syphilis Infection?

Hi Dr. I am having some itching on the tip of my Penis, and there are some penile ulcer on the upper skin of my penis. I am having sore throat since last 2 weeks which is not recovering. I also suffered from common flu few days back, so thinking sore throat might be related to it. I had some lesions in the lower gum also. Almost 2 months back, I had a sex with a guy from whom I might have contacted the disease. Is it a case of Syphilis , my VDRL test showed reactive. Please suggest what should be my next steps...

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hi sumanta,

Penile ulcer, sore throat, gum lesions and history of unprotected sex two months back with positive VDRL test is consistent with the diagnosis of syphilis. Sometimes VDRL may be falsely positive, so if you want to confirm the diagnosis you can go for other confirmatory tests like TPHA or FTA-Abs.
Since Syphilis can be effectively treated with antibiotics its always better to start the treatment as early as possible...
